One of the first things you’ll notice in these new UFORCE Highland models is the modern, tech-forward cockpit. Front and center is an 8-inch CFMOTO RideSync touchscreen display that supports Apple CarPlay integration​. This means you can connect your iPhone and access your favorite apps, music, and navigation on the dash – a rare convenience in the UTV world. The screen also doubles as a hub for vehicle info, advanced diagnostics, and audio controls​, giving the driver intuitive control over the machine’s systems.

CFMOTO didn’t stop at the infotainment – they also upgraded the drivetrain tech. The UFORCE Highland models have CFMOTO’s new OmniDrive™ CVT transmission and an E-Shift system for push-button gear selection​. Instead of a traditional gear lever, you can press a button to shift between high, low, neutral, or reverse, and the OmniDrive CVT ensures power delivery is smooth and seamless. To top it off, an electronic parking brake with auto-disengage is standard, so the brake will automatically release when you hit the gas, making it easier to get going on a hill or towing a load​. This blend of high-tech features means operating the UFORCE Highland is more convenient and car-like than ever.

Comfort and Convenience

CFMOTO UFORCE HVAC options built the Highland editions with comfort in mind, turning the UFORCE into a weatherproof workhorse. Both the U10 Pro Highland and U10 XL Pro Highland come with a factory-installed HVAC system – yes, heating and air conditioning right in the cab​. Whether plowing snow in January or trail riding in July, you can stay warm in the winter and cool in the summer at the flip of a switch. The fully enclosed cabin features automotive-style power windows in the doors and even a rear sliding window to vent the cabin as needed​. For even more airflow, the front windshield is a tip-out design that you can crack open or close up tight if it’s dusty or raining​. Inside the cab, the Highland models offer an upgraded experience for the driver and passengers. The driver’s seat is adjustable, and the steering wheel tilts, allowing operators to find a comfortable driving position​. The interior also comes with a roof headliner for a finished look, and a set of audio speakers to enjoy music or radio while you work or play​. Overall, the UFORCE Highland’s cabin gives off a premium vibe – almost like a pickup truck – with its blend of technology and creature comforts, making those long days on the trail or job site far more enjoyable.

CFMOTO UFORCE HVAC options: Performance and Power

Don’t let the luxury fool you – these UTVs are still built to perform on rugged terrain. Under the hood, a 998cc three-cylinder engine delivers 88 horsepower with the help of variable valve timing​. This inline triple is designed to provide strong torque while running smoothly and quietly, so it’s just as ready to haul heavy loads as it is to cruise the trails​. The Highland models also feature around 13 inches of ground clearance and a suspension with 11 inches of travel, so they can crawl over rocks, ruts, and uneven ground without breaking a sweat​

When it comes to utility, CFMOTO made sure you’re well-equipped. Every UFORCE Highland comes with a 4,500 lb winch up front – perfect for pulling the machine out of a sticky situation or helping yank obstacles out of the way​​. There’s also a 150-amp high-output charging system on board, meaning the alternator/stator can handle plenty of accessories and keep the battery charged even when running the A/C, lights, and other add-ons simultaneously​. Other performance goodies include turf mode (so you can unlock the rear differential for tight turns on delicate ground) and hill descent control, which electronically manages braking on steep downhills for added safety​. All these capabilities ensure that the Highland models are not just comfy, but also fully prepared for hard work and challenging off-road conditions.

CFMOTO UFORCE HVAC options: Models, Pricing & Availability

CFMOTO UFORCE HVAC options offer the Highland package in two configurations to suit different needs. The UFORCE U10 Pro Highland is a two-door model with a single bench seat that comfortably accommodates up to 3 passengers​. Its big brother, the UFORCE U10 XL Pro Highland, stretches the chassis to add a second row, giving it four doors and bench seating for up to 6 passengers (great for crews or families)​. Both versions come with the same engine and feature set; the main difference is the passenger capacity and longer wheelbase of the XL.

In terms of style, buyers can choose from three factory color options: a sleek Nebula Black, a glossy Bordeaux Red, or a camouflaged TrueTimber Camo finish​. The MSRP for the UFORCE U10 Pro Highland starts at $23,999, while the larger UFORCE U10 XL Pro Highland comes in at $26,999 in the U.S. market​. Considering all the extras included (HVAC, touchscreen, winch, etc.), the Highland models are positioned as value-packed alternatives to pricier fully-outfitted UTVs.

The new UFORCE Highland series is rolling out as part of CFMOTO’s 2025 lineup, and units should be arriving at dealerships soon.
